
  • create the constructor for the class PrimeSieve
  • get user number input
  • create empty list item
  • for loop to add number to the list (from 2 to userInput)
  • prime should be equal to 2
  • remove multiples of prime from the list

prime = 2, prime = 3 ... {2,3,4,5,6,7,8,9,10}

2 {3,5,7,9}


3 {5,7}

container = list1

loop{list1} i++ remove items from the list1 container = list1 loop{list1} remove items from the list1

iterate i

for(prime = 2; prime< list.length; prime+prime) { if list.remove() }